θῶσιν

Lemma: τίθημι

verb verb
10 views Added Mar 13, 2026

Definition

to put, place, or set; to lay down or establish (e.g. a law, proposal, or plan). In the middle, to place for oneself, appoint, or adopt; in the passive, to be set or placed.

Grammatical Analysis

"θῶσιν"

Verb class: -μι verb (τίθημι)

Tense: aorist (second aorist)

Voice: active

Mood: subjunctive

Person: 3rd

Number: plural

Note: Form is from the aorist stem θε-/θω- of τίθημι: θῶσι(ν) = 'that they put/place'; movable nu may appear as θῶσιν.
